Mediastinal Hibernoma: A Rare Case with Radiologic-Pathologic Correlation
Figure 2
Contrast enhanced axial CT (a) with coronal (b) and sagittal (c) CT reconstructions of the chest demonstrating a well circumscribed, heterogeneously enhancing mass (green arrows) with areas of fat attenuation (blue arrow pointing to ROI in (a)) and a few mildly prominent internal vessels (red arrow heads in (b)) within the superior, posterior right mediastinum.
